Car Detailing Prices

Car detailing prices are primarily influenced by vehicle size, type, and the specific services selected. Basic detailing packages may start from £129, covering essential exterior washes and tire dressing.

More thorough services, such as interior detailing, can range up to £900, depending on vehicle condition and size.

Luxury options, including ceramic coatings and specialised treatments, further increase costs.

Standard Detailing Services Explained

Understanding the components of standard car detailing services is key to evaluating their impact on overall vehicle maintenance and cost.

The detailing process integrates various techniques to maintain the aesthetic and functional aspects of vehicles.

Below is a table illustrating the typical services included in standard detailing along with a basic pricing breakdown for each in the UK.

ServicePrice Range (£)
Exterior Wash50 – 100
Waxing50 – 150
Wheel Cleaning30 – 70
Tire Dressing20 – 40
Interior Detailing80 – 150

These services contribute to preserving the vehicle’s value, enhancing its appearance, and ensuring its longevity.

Comparing Detailing With Valeting

Car detailing involves a thorough and meticulous approach to vehicle maintenance, greatly exceeding the scope of standard car valeting in regards to depth and detail.

While valeting provides a basic level of cleanliness and upkeep, detailing explores extensive techniques to restore and enhance the vehicle’s aesthetics.

This quality comparison highlights detailing’s focus on high-end finishes, including paint correction and ceramic coatings, which are absent in typical valeting.

Moreover, although detailing demands a greater time investment, this meticulous process guarantees a superior, lasting outcome.

For clients prioritising time efficiency, valeting might seem advantageous due to its quicker turnaround.

However, detailing offers enduring value, preserving the vehicle’s condition and potentially increasing its resale value.

Frequently Asked Questions

How Much Does Car Detailing Cost in the UK?

Car detailing costs in the UK typically range from £129 to £900, influenced by service variability and geographic differences. Premium services may exceed this range due to specialised treatments and enhancements provided.

How Much Is a Typical Detail?

A typical detail encompasses a range of services, influenced by service variability and detailing packages offered. Costs vary widely, typically between £80 and £200, based on vehicle size and specific service requirements.
